Nestled in the heart of Stanthorpe, southern Queensland, Washpool Supply Co. Pty Ltd is a purpose-built store offering natural soap, skincare products, home health items, and giftware. The store is known for its handmade soaps and body products made on-site using natural ingredients that create incredible scents. Visitors can explore a wide range of products including soaps, candles, handwash, lotions, lip balms and even dog shampoo.

The Granite Belt Farmers Market in Stanthorpe is a small but vibrant market that offers a wide range of genuine, locally sourced products. Visitors can explore and support local small businesses while enjoying access to an assortment of items such as humanely raised pork, honey, yacon root, mulled apple juice, plants, vegetables, herbs, and more. This market is known for its exceptional fruit and vegetable offerings that showcase the best of the region's produce.

Granite Belt Christmas Farm is a year-round working Christmas tree farm in Stanthorpe, Queensland. Visitors can stroll through the tree-lined paths and enjoy the scent of fresh pine. The farm features Santa's animals, including reindeer, donkeys, goats, sheep, ducks, and chickens for kids to feed. The Mistletoe Christmas store offers a wide array of Christmas gifts, decorations, and handmade foods. In December, visitors can select their favorite tree for the holiday season.

Kent Saddlery, located on the New England Highway in Stanthorpe, offers a unique gallery-style retail space where visitors can immerse themselves in the world of handcrafted leather products. The store exudes an old-time saddlery charm and invites guests to interact with their beautifully crafted items. Customers can explore the Heritage Collection and other leather goods while enjoying the distinct aroma of quality leather. Visitors have praised the exceptional service and attention to detail, whether shopping in-store or online.

Nestled in the heart of the Warwick to Tenterfield region, M&M Timber & Building Supplies has earned its reputation as a top-notch provider of high-quality hardwood and essential hardware. Originally known as M&M Sawmill, this family-owned business has been a staple since 1989, evolving from a modest sawmill into a comprehensive resource for timber and building supplies. Customers rave about the exceptional service and knowledgeable advice they receive while shopping here.

Artworks Granite Belt is a charming creative community hub located in the heritage Stanthorpe railway station. It serves as a meeting place for art enthusiasts, offering weekly art group meetings and showcasing impressive local artwork. The adjacent heritage gardens are meticulously maintained, providing a beautiful backdrop for visitors to enjoy. The on-site café offers delicious homemade meals at great value, with options such as salads, lasagna, and nachos.
